Elevate Your Operations A Comprehensive Guide to Nagios Monitoring Setup with Informatics Systems

10/26/2023

In today's fast-paced digital landscape, ensuring the reliability and performance of your IT infrastructure is paramount. Nagios, an industry-standard open-source monitoring system, offers robust capabilities for monitoring the health of your systems, services, and network devices. In this comprehensive guide, we will delve into the world of Nagios Monitoring Setup and introduce Informatics Systems, a leading service provider in this domain, renowned for their expertise in architecting and implementing monitoring solutions.

Chapter 1: Understanding Nagios Monitoring

1.1 What is Nagios?

Nagios is a powerful monitoring system that allows you to monitor hosts, services, and network devices, and alert you when things go wrong. It provides a centralized view of your IT infrastructure and helps in proactively identifying and resolving issues.

1.2 Key Concepts in Nagios Monitoring

  • Hosts and Services: The entities that Nagios monitors, such as servers, applications, and network devices.
  • Checks and Plugins: Scripts or executables that perform specific tests on hosts or services.
  • Alerting and Notifications: The process of notifying stakeholders when a problem is detected.

Chapter 2: The Need for Professional Nagios Monitoring Setup

As businesses rely on complex IT infrastructures, the importance of robust monitoring and alerting cannot be overstated. Informatics Systems recognizes the critical need for expert Nagios Monitoring Setup services.

2.1 Benefits of Professional Nagios Monitoring Setup

  • Proactive Issue Identification: Detect and address issues before they impact operations.
  • Resource Optimization: Identify opportunities for resource optimization and cost reduction.
  • Performance Optimization: Fine-tune monitoring checks for optimal response to specific conditions.
  • Security and Compliance: Implement checks for security incidents and compliance violations.

2.2 Informatics Systems: Your Nagios Monitoring Setup Partner

Informatics Systems boasts a team of certified experts with a track record of successfully architecting and implementing monitoring solutions. Their deep knowledge and experience ensure that your monitoring setup is in safe hands.

Chapter 3: Preparing for Nagios Monitoring Setup

Before implementing Nagios Monitoring, there are crucial steps to be taken. Informatics Systems follows a comprehensive approach to understanding your organization's unique needs.

3.1 Infrastructure Assessment

  • Inventory Identification: Identify all hosts, services, and network devices that need to be monitored.
  • Check Requirements: Determine the specific checks and plugins required for each entity.

3.2 Customization and Integration

  • Plugin Selection and Configuration: Identify and configure plugins to extend Nagios functionality.
  • Integration with Other Monitoring Tools: Integrate Nagios with other monitoring solutions for comprehensive coverage.

Chapter 4: Setting Up Nagios Monitoring

Informatics Systems' seasoned team follows a systematic approach to setting up Nagios Monitoring.

4.1 Host and Service Definition

  • Host Configuration: Define hosts and their attributes, such as IP addresses and host groups.
  • Service Configuration: Define services associated with each host, specifying checks to be performed.

4.2 Check Configuration and Plugins

  • Plugin Installation: Install and configure plugins to perform specific checks on hosts and services.
  • Custom Plugin Development: Develop custom plugins for specialized monitoring requirements.

Chapter 5: Best Practices for Nagios Monitoring Setup

Informatics Systems introduces best practices to maximize the benefits of Nagios Monitoring.

5.1 Granular Monitoring Checks

  • Specific Checks: Define monitoring checks tailored to the specific needs of each host and service.
  • Thresholds and Alerting Rules: Set appropriate thresholds for generating alerts based on check results.

5.2 Business Process Monitoring

  • Service Dependencies: Define dependencies between services to accurately reflect the impact of failures on business processes.
  • Scheduled Downtime: Implement scheduled downtime for planned maintenance to prevent unnecessary alerts.

Chapter 6: Integrating Nagios with Other Tools

Nagios can be seamlessly integrated with other monitoring, notification, and ticketing systems. Informatics Systems guides organizations in seamless integration.

6.1 Integration with Alerting Systems

  • Integration with Alertmanager: Integrate with Alertmanager or other alerting systems for centralized alert handling and routing.
  • Silencing Rules: Implement silencing rules to temporarily suppress non-critical alerts.

6.2 Integration with Ticketing Systems

  • Integration with ServiceNow, Jira, etc.: Automatically create tickets for incidents detected by Nagios for streamlined incident management.

Chapter 7: Monitoring and Reporting

Keeping a close eye on your alerts and responses is crucial for their effectiveness and reliability.

7.1 Nagios Web Interface

  • Alert History and Status: Monitor the status and history of alerts in the Nagios web interface.
  • Performance Data and Graphs: Access detailed performance graphs for hosts and services.

7.2 Reporting and Trend Analysis

  • Trend Analysis: Use historical data to identify trends and plan for future capacity needs.
  • Custom Reporting: Create custom reports to track specific KPIs and metrics.

Chapter 8: Security and Compliance

Informatics Systems ensures that your Nagios Monitoring Setup adheres to security and compliance standards.

8.1 Access Control and Permissions

  • Role-Based Access Control (RBAC): Assign specific roles and permissions for Nagios configuration and management.
  • Access Reviews: Conduct regular reviews to ensure proper access control.

8.2 Compliance and Auditing

  • Configuration Audits: Conduct periodic audits to ensure monitoring checks align with compliance requirements.
  • Incident Response: Establish incident response procedures for security-related alerts.

Chapter 9: Disaster Recovery and Backup

Informatics Systems ensures data integrity and disaster recovery capabilities for your monitoring setup.

9.1 Configuration Versioning

  • Source Control Integration: Store Nagios configurations in version control for backup and versioning.
  • Automated Backup Routines: Implement automated backup routines for Nagios configurations.

9.2 Redundancy and Failover Planning

  • High Availability Setup: Implement redundancy for critical Nagios components.
  • Failover Testing: Regularly test failover scenarios to ensure system resilience.

Chapter 10: Maintenance and Support

Informatics Systems provides ongoing support and maintenance to keep your Nagios Monitoring Setup running smoothly.

10.1 Nagios Updates and Upgrades

  • Regular Server Maintenance: Apply updates and security patches to the Nagios server.
  • Plugin Updates: Keep Nagios plugins and integrations current.

10.2 Troubleshooting and Support

  • Incident Response: Swiftly address any issues or outages in your monitoring setup.
  • 24/7 Support: Round-the-clock assistance for critical incidents.

Conclusion

In conclusion, Nagios Monitoring Setup is a critical component in ensuring the reliability and performance of your IT infrastructure. Informatics Systems stands as a trusted partner, offering end-to-end support from initial assessment to ongoing maintenance. By choosing Informatics Systems, businesses can embark on their Nagios Monitoring Setup journey with confidence, knowing they have a partner dedicated to their success in the dynamic world of IT operations. Contact Informatics Systems today to elevate your operations with Nagios Monitoring Setup.

Comments

No posts found

Write a review